Responsibilities
- Drive total cost of ownership improvements including supplier performance and develop the supply base, to deliver results for stakeholders and in line with the organization’s Business Plan.
- Develops tools and techniques to profile; benchmark; research and assess the market; risks; competition; trends and new opportunities to ensure continuity of supply and maximize value / competitive advantage.
- Trusted advisor to client groups, providing expertise and advice on new business approaches to category strategy, sourcing and supplier/ contract management.
- Leads effective cross-organizational teams to develop and implement strategies to meet objectives and targets.
- Acts as a role model, and technical expert, independently provides coaching and mentoring.
- Leads and supervises a team of Procurement Professionals to deliver effective procurement strategies and meeting company objectives.
- Develops the strategy and manages the execution of supplier and stakeholder relationships for their assigned category.
- Develops and manages the implementation of supplier relationship management plans.
- Leads negotiations with suppliers.
- Coordinates with the business to ensure the management of supplier relationships.
- Works with others to resolve and escalate supplier issues.
- Produces and analyzes SRM scorecards.
- Monitors contract and supplier performance including KPIs, reviews with business groups and uses to improve future performance and strategy development.
- Ensures contracts are being managed to meet category strategic objectives and the benefits framework.
- Executes a multi-year category strategy and annual procurement plan that aligns with business forecast / objectives.
- In consultation with the Manager, ensures the development of compelling business cases to support decision-making and obtain approval.
- Utilizes their knowledge of business needs and understanding of the market structure to make recommendations on how changes in business processes can improve ways to go to market; structure the sourcing approach and contract.
- Develops and manages project plans to ensure strategies are executed on schedule and achieve projected financial / operational benefits.
- Identifies risks and makes recommendations for mitigation.
- Provide support for and adhere to all procurement policies and procedures and ensure compliance.
- Support all audit requests to maintain compliance to corporate policies.
- Writes and presents business plans, briefs, category management plans and other documents to management and key internal and external stakeholders.
- Negotiates and executes large to very large dollar / complex contracts.
